The Bereavement Journey is a 6-week course, facilitated by Churches in the Carlisle area using national bereavement care resources for all who have been bereaved (thebereavementjourney.org) A winter course will be run in person on Wednesday lunchtimes starting on 11th January 2023. Another repeat course in 2023 is hoped to be run in person in the Carlisle area or online using Zoom.
THE BEREAVEMENT JOURNEY is a space to learn more about how bereavement affects us, listen to others in their grief, and make connections with our own. We aim to feel comfortable with people who have their own experience of grief and can support you in yours.
The initial 5 sessions are set out for all faiths and none, with a 6th optional session exploring a Christian response to bereavement.
